The camp was in Sakon Nakhon province, 50 km from Nakhon Phanom. Distance incorrect read comments why
Apparently the camp was only in existence from 1966 to 1971.
The occupants were the 809th Engineer Battalion. The battalion was deactivated February 3, 1971
In 1968 the authorized strength was 905.
The battalion had done extensive construction projects throughout Thailand, including the capital.

"In August(1966), the main portion of Company C was moved to Sakhon Nakhon where it built a troop cantonment area, a Special Forces camp, and a POL tank farm at Nakhom Phanom (NKP)"
Few pictures seem to indicate it was typical barracks of the day, wooden huts most likely dismantled by locals for the lumber.

The Sakon Nakhon Wax Castle Festival and Royal Longboat Races are based on the lunar calendar, and coincide with the end of the Buddhist lent.
This year the full moon is on October 18
Based on the history of this event, this year's event will most likely be October 14 through 19

Sakon Nakhon Hottest
This year has seen some of the hottest weather.
My latest electric bill attests to that.
A previous high of US$ 115 has been trumped this year with my latest electric bill (March 20- April 20) US$165
Even though there are plenty sunny days ahead, the monthly forecast for May foresees a lot more rainy days.
This is either a prelude to the rainy season, or the earliest start to the rainy season I've experienced (since 2003).
With rainy day weather you'd expect more moderate temperatures. In fact temperatures will drop occasionally. We won't notice it though. For now high humidity will drive up the feels like temperature.
Feels like temperatures through mid May will stay in the low to mid forties.
